Hello.

  This patch removes obsolete PREFERRED_RELOAD_CLASS macro from SPARC back end
in the GCC and introduces equivalent TARGET_PREFERRED_RELOAD_CLASS target 
hooks.

   Bootstrapped and regression tested on sparc64-unknown-linux-gnu.

  OK to install?

        * config/sparc/sparc.h (PREFERRED_RELOAD_CLASS): Remove.
        * config/sparc/sparc.c (TARGET_PREFERRED_RELOAD_CLASS): Define.
        (sparc_preferred_reload_class): New function.

Eric Botcazou April 3, 2011, 8:02 p.m. UTC | #1
>         * config/sparc/sparc.h (PREFERRED_RELOAD_CLASS): Remove.
>         * config/sparc/sparc.c (TARGET_PREFERRED_RELOAD_CLASS): Define.
>         (sparc_preferred_reload_class): New function.

OK, modulo

> +      if (FP_REG_CLASS_P (rclass)
> +         || rclass == GENERAL_OR_FP_REGS
> +         || rclass == GENERAL_OR_EXTRA_FP_REGS
> +         || (GET_MODE_CLASS (GET_MODE (x)) == MODE_FLOAT && ! TARGET_FPU)
> +         || (GET_MODE (x) == TFmode && ! const_zero_operand (x, TFmode)))
> +       return NO_REGS;
> +      else if (!FP_REG_CLASS_P (rclass)
> +              && GET_MODE_CLASS (GET_MODE (x)) == MODE_INT)
> +       return GENERAL_REGS;

Drop the else and the useless !FP_REG_CLASS_P (rclass) test:

+      if (FP_REG_CLASS_P (rclass)
+         || rclass == GENERAL_OR_FP_REGS
+         || rclass == GENERAL_OR_EXTRA_FP_REGS
+         || (GET_MODE_CLASS (GET_MODE (x)) == MODE_FLOAT && ! TARGET_FPU)
+         || (GET_MODE (x) == TFmode && ! const_zero_operand (x, TFmode)))
+       return NO_REGS;
+
+      if (GET_MODE_CLASS (GET_MODE (x)) == MODE_INT)
+       return GENERAL_REGS;

No need to retest, just make sure this compiles and install, thanks.

+/* Implement TARGET_PREFERRED_RELOAD_CLASS
+
+   - We can't load constants into FP registers.
+   - We can't load FP constants into integer registers when soft-float,
+     because there is no soft-float pattern with a r/F constraint.
+   - We can't load FP constants into integer registers for TFmode unless
+     it is 0.0L, because there is no movtf pattern with a r/F constraint.
+   - Try and reload integer constants (symbolic or otherwise) back into
+     registers directly, rather than having them dumped to memory.  */
+
+static reg_class_t
+sparc_preferred_reload_class (rtx x, reg_class_t rclass)
+{
+  if (CONSTANT_P (x))
+    {
+      if (FP_REG_CLASS_P (rclass)
+         || rclass == GENERAL_OR_FP_REGS
+         || rclass == GENERAL_OR_EXTRA_FP_REGS
+         || (GET_MODE_CLASS (GET_MODE (x)) == MODE_FLOAT && ! TARGET_FPU)
+         || (GET_MODE (x) == TFmode && ! const_zero_operand (x, TFmode)))
+       return NO_REGS;
+      else if (!FP_REG_CLASS_P (rclass)
+              && GET_MODE_CLASS (GET_MODE (x)) == MODE_INT)
+       return GENERAL_REGS;
+    }
+
+  return rclass;
+}
